Crossfire

Looking like an infamous holo-screen star has it's advantages. So it was for the man known as Crossfire. Sure his uncanny likeness facilitated his ability to "entertain" impressionable ladies, but more usefully, the sheer necessity of avoiding the crowds notice required the perfection of an art, the art of stealth.

When the war started Crossfire was no different from any other unschooled but patriotic youth, he enlisted as such youths have always done and unwittingly did the bidding of older, richer men.

The Marines took the likeable mischievous lad and went to work on him, they trained him and put him to work on the enemy. Eventually there was nothing left of the lad, just the killing machine Crossfire had become.

In those days mutations were never considered, never tested. No-one guessed at the subtle, quiet powers at work within Crossfire, indeed he had no idea himself what made him tick, what made him so very deadly at his job.
